How Long After Drying a Hot Runner Can It Be Started Up?

I. Standard Startup Time

Applicable Scenarios: The hot runner has completed the entire baking process according to specifications. After drying, the insulation resistance is stable at ≥20MΩ, and the temperature rise curve is completely normal without any abnormalities.

Total Startup Time: After cooling to below 60℃, complete wiring and installation within 1 hour. After heating to the production temperature and confirming that the parameters are normal, production can begin directly.

 

II. Startup Time Corresponding to Different Moisture Levels

Slightly Moist Hot Runner: After drying, cool for 30 minutes. Retest the insulation resistance; if there is no drop, complete the wiring and heat to the production temperature before starting up. Total time ≤1.5 hours.

Moderately Moist Hot Runner: After drying, allow it to cool naturally for 1 hour. Retest the insulation resistance; if it is stable and meets the standard, heat to 100℃ and hold for 30 minutes. Then heat to the production temperature before starting up. Total time ≤2 hours. Severely Moisturized Hot Runner System: After drying, allow natural cooling for 1.5 hours. Retest insulation resistance twice; if it is ≥50MΩ, raise the temperature to 100℃ and hold for 1 hour. Gradually raise the temperature to the production temperature before starting the machine. Total time ≤3 hours.

 

III. Start-up Adjustment Rules for Special Environments

In high-humidity environments such as the rainy season/humid season, after drying, raise the machine to 100℃ and hold for 30 minutes to prevent secondary moisture absorption during cooling. Then raise the temperature to the production temperature before starting the machine.

For large multi-cavity hot runner systems, after raising the temperature to the production temperature, hold for an additional 30 minutes to ensure uniform temperature throughout the entire channel before starting production.

If the insulation resistance still slowly decreases after drying, extend the holding time to 120℃ for 1 hour for dehumidification. Retest the insulation resistance; if it passes the test, then raise the temperature and start the machine.

 

IV. Final Confirmation Conditions Before Start-up

After the hot runner reaches the production temperature, retest the high-temperature insulation resistance; if it is ≥0.1MΩ, the temperature deviation of all sensors is ≤±1℃, and there are no abnormal alarms, then the machine can be officially started for production.
